Job summary

A reputable automotive recruitment agency is seeking an experienced HGV Technician / Mechanic / Fitter to join a well-established commercial vehicle workshop in Lincoln. The role involves carrying out repairs, assisting in fault diagnosis, and ensuring compliance with warranty procedures. Candidates must have previous experience, be apprentice trained to NVQ level 3 in Heavy Vehicle Mechanics, and possess their own tools. The position offers a competitive salary and a supportive work environment.
